Commissioner McCarty to Step Down May 2

Insurance Commissioner Kevin McCarty announced today that he is resigning as of May 2, 2016.  According to a release from the Florida Office of Insurance Regulation, Commissioner McCarty is resigning to pursue other job opportunities.  Commissioner McCarty has served as Insurance Commissioner since 2003, when the Office of Insurance Regulation was created in connection with other restructuring of Florida’s government. “The privilege of serving […]

Florida Homeowners Insurers Pass Stress Test

The Florida Office of Insurance Regulation released a report summarizing the results of its annual reinsurance data call and stress test.  Under the stress test, residential property insurers are required to identify how their reinsurance programs would respond to several hurricane scenarios, including a single large event or multiple smaller events.  According to the OIR’s […]

OIR Highlights Economic Impact of Insurance Industry

Insurance Commissioner Kevin McCarty appeared before the Governor and Cabinet last week to discuss potential standards under which the Office of Insurance Regulation can be objectively reviewed.  The Governor and Cabinet have indicated that they want to hear from the agencies they oversee, including the Office of Insurance Regulation, regarding appropriate measurements for their agencies. Commissioner Welcomes Large Crowd to OIR Conference

Insurance Commissioner Kevin McCarty welcomed a large group to Tallahassee on October 30, 2014, for the Office of Insurance Regulation’s 2014 industry conference entitled, “Navigating the Changing Insurance Environment.” The conference drew a large number of participants in person at the Florida State University Turnbull Conference Center, and others participated remotely through a live webcast.
